phy: fix crash in fixed_phy_add()
Since e7f4dc3536a ("mdio: Move allocation of interrupts into core"), platforms which call fixed_phy_add() before fixed_mdio_bus_init() is called (for example, because the platform code and the fixed_phy driver use the same initcall level) crash in fixed_phy_add() since the ->mii_bus is not allocated. Also since e7f4dc3536a, these interrupts are initalized to polling by default. The few (old) platforms which directly use fixed_phy_add() from their platform code all pass PHY_POLL for the irq argument, so we can keep these platforms not crashing by simply not attempting to set the irq if PHY_POLL is passed. Also, even if problems have not been reported on more modern platforms which used fixed_phy_register() from drivers' probe functions, we return -EPROBE_DEFER if the MDIO bus is not yet registered so that the probe is retried later.
